Hidden Household Vermin



Are you aware of the covert home insects that may be prowling in your home? While you may be vigilant about typical parasites like ants or spiders, there are various other tricky trespassers that could be creating damage behind the scenes.



One such insect is the silverfish, a tiny pest that flourishes in damp and dark settings like basements and shower rooms. These pests can harm books, garments, and also wallpaper, making them a problem to take care of.

One more surprise bug to look out for is the rug beetle. These small insects prey on a selection of products located in homes, such as carpets, garments, and upholstery. Their larvae can cause substantial damage if left uncontrolled, making it crucial to resolve any type of signs of problem immediately.

Additionally, mold and mildew termites are usually overlooked however can suggest a dampness problem in your house. These small creatures eat mold and can worsen allergies for delicate individuals. Keeping your home dry and well-ventilated can assist stop these insects from residing in your living spaces.

Sneaky Home Invaders



While you might be diligent in keeping your home tidy and organized, sneaky home intruders can still locate their method unnoticed. These pests are masters of hiding in plain sight, making it vital to remain alert in identifying their existence.

Right here are a few sly home intruders you should look out for:

1. ** Silverfish **: These small, silvery bugs enjoy moist, dark spaces like cellars and restrooms. They feed upon starchy products and can trigger damage to publications, wallpaper, and garments.

2. ** Rug Beetles **: Frequently mistaken for safe ladybugs, carpet beetles can ruin your home. Their larvae feed upon all-natural fibers like woollen and silk, creating irreparable damages to carpets, clothing, and furniture.

3. ** Earwigs **: In spite of their ominous-looking pincers, earwigs are even more of a problem than a danger. They're drawn in to moisture and can discover their method right into your home with splits and holes. Watch out for them in wet areas like bathroom and kitchens.
